Output 42db61f5b45b1cf6f57486103b53a5ca081b82f0fadd07336440e070d6a0bbc8:187

value
37690336
script pubkey
OP_0 OP_PUSHBYTES_20 ebbbfbbe6ccadf7bcf739476e78e8c9b0f9f8468
address
bc1qawalh0nvet0hhnmnj3mw0r5vnv8elprgyn9uru
transaction
42db61f5b45b1cf6f57486103b53a5ca081b82f0fadd07336440e070d6a0bbc8
confirmations
255602
spent
true